There’s a new starter bracelet coming out from Trollbeads on Friday, October 18. For $120 USD it consists of a silver chain, lock, silver bead and glass bead. The lock and bead are designed by Ragnar R. Jørgensen. The glass is a grape purple with a hint of blue.
On the reverse side of the lock is some pretty scrollwork.
I decided to make a full combination using lots of black beads and the Soft Wind of Change Pendant, which was also designed by Jørgensen.
Here’s the bracelet just by itself. The Shimmer Royal Beads play nicely with the new purple bead.

My thoughts about this new starter bracelet are that it is a good deal for someone new to Trollbeads or to give as a gift. The heart lock is a love it or loathe it kind of piece and of course, I always like purple but some people don’t. Amazingly, the purple flowers in my photos were given to me by my purple hating friend, Trisha! There wasn’t much buzz about this bracelet so I am guessing a lot of people were underwhelmed, but I would love to hear your thoughts.
Disclosure: As always, this sample was given to me by Trollbeads USA.
